A Streetcar Named Desire

by Tennessee Williams

A Streetcar Named Desire Cover

Synopses & Reviews

Publisher Comments:

The story of Blanche DuBois and her last grasp at happiness, and of Stanley Kowalski, the one who destroyed her chance.
